- The distance between Kaitoke, New Zealand and Milagro, Ecuador is approximately 11,120 km or 6,910 mi.
- To reach Kaitoke in this distance one would set out from Milagro bearing 227.6°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Kaitoke bearing 281.7° or WNW .
- Kaitoke has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Milagro has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Kaitoke is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ome whereas Milagro is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 13.9 °C (25°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.6 °C (11.9°F) more in Kaitoke.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 813.1 mm (32 in) more which is equivalent to 813.1 l/m² (19.96 US gal/ft²) or 8,131,000 l/ha (869,258 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 26.2° lower in Kaitoke than in Milagro.
